Slots in Technology
In technology, a slot is a functional space designed to hold or connect components. These include:
- Memory slots for installing RAM in computers.
- Expansion slots for graphics cards, sound cards, or other peripherals.
- Card or SIM slots in devices, providing additional functionality or connectivity.
Slots in technology allow systems to grow, adapt, and function efficiently. By providing a specific place for components, they make upgrades, repairs, and modifications straightforward, transforming rigid machines into flexible systems.

Slots in Time Management
A slot can also represent a reserved period of time. Time slots organize schedules and activities, making planning more efficient:
- Booking appointments or meetings.
- Allocating periods for work, study, or events.
- Dividing tasks into manageable segments throughout the day.
Time slots bring clarity and order, turning the abstract concept of time into actionable, structured opportunities.
